Mipro ACT-74

The Mipro ACT-74 quad channel UHF radio mic receiver operates on channel 38. Licence required.

There are 400 preset channels on the ACT74 with a user defined group to save up to 16 channels.

48 compatible channels for maximum flexibility.

The colour VFD screen offers comprehensive system status information including: group, channel, frequency, name, RF & audio signal strength, diversity condition, transmitter battery level, squelch level and indication of interference.

True diversity operation ensures a long transmission range and freedom of movement and the Automatic Channel Targetting (ACT) feature makes system set up extremely simple by matching and synchronising transmitters and receiver at the press of a button.

The ACT-7 series receivers also have an advanced computer network-interfaced control feature which enables the system to be set up, controlled and monitored by PC using an optional Mipro hardware device via RS-232 or USB.

  • EIA standard 1U rack-mountable metal chassis with excellent heat dissipation & RF shielding characteristics.
  • UHF PLL-synthesized technology for enhanced RF stability, lowered spurious emissions and increased frequency agility.
  • 400 preset channels with 1-set of user-defined group that saves up to 16 channels.
  • Industry’s first ACT syncs automatically and quickly a working channel.
  • Dual “PiloTone & NoiseLock” circuits minimize interference.
  • Industry’s only full-colour VFD screen delivers a bright, clear viewing in day/night environments with automatic lit (Working) and dim (Standby) display during performance.
  • All controls are intuitive and easily setup via a single rotary knob.
  • Industry’s only RF interference warning indicator for properly adjusts the SQ level. Increase sensitivity to extend receiving range; decrease the sensitivity to reduce interference.
  • Single channel output or mixed output and switchable three levels for the best sound quality options.
  • High dynamic range and high fidelity characteristics for transparent audio performance.
  • Receiver provides bias voltage for MIPRO antenna systems to enhance reception range and signal stability.
  • MIPRO RCS.Net software allows real-time computer set up, control and monitoring.
  • Built-in 100 – 240V AC switching power supply ensures system safety and stability.
Channel Quad
Chassis EIA standard 19″ 1U
Frequency Range UHF 482 – 698 MHz (US), UHF 480 – 874 MHz (EU)
Bandwidth 72 MHz
Preset Channels 400 preset channels
Group 01 – 10: 16 compatible channels in each group
Group 11 – 15: 48 compatible channels in each group
Group 16: 16 channels can be saved & recalled (user-defined)
Receiving Mode True diversity
Oscillation Mode PLL synthesized
Sensitivity 6 dBμV at S/N > 80 dB
S/N Ratio > 108 dB(A)
T.H.D. < 0.5% @ 1 kHz
Frequency Response 50 Hz – 18 kHz, with high-pass filter
Squelch “PiloTone & NoiseLock” dual-squelch circuit
Audio Output Adjustment Output level accurately pre-adjusted to equal to the microphone capsule sensitivity.
Maximum Output Level +16dBV / 0dBV / -6dBV
Output Connectors Balanced XLR
Output Switch Single channel output or mixed output
Operation Manual or PC remote control via optional software
Power Supply Built-in 100 – 240 AC switching power
Power Consumption 24 W
Dimensions (W × H × D) 482 × 44 × 265 mm / 19 × 1.7 × 10.5 “
Weight Approx. 3.4 kg / 7.5 lbs
